INCOMING STITCH so here's how you can try to prevent this Cut your risk of Travelers diarrhea Last one may surprise you most stomach bugs are passed fecal oral so that means that people's poop is on everything we touch we're talking about door handles, elevator buttons, shopping carts, grocery store items so wash your hands right before you eat ideally with soap and water eat freshly cooked food that's served hot avoid foods that have been sitting out at room temperature especially in the airport avoid raw salads, unpeeled fruits and uncooked vegetables drink only factory sealed beverages and avoid tap water and ice if you can finally if you're traveling to a high risk area if you take bismuth before and during your trip you can reduce your risk of traveler's diarrhea by up to 65% but you just have to make sure you take it before and while you're on your trip and make sure you clear that with your doctors share this with your travel buddy I'm a board certified gastroenterologist so hit that follow button if you found these tips helpful
